The
Water-Energy-Food (WEF) Nexus has emerged as a central analytical and policy
framework for managing interdependent resource systems in water-scarce
environments. This study examines the optimization of the WEF Nexus for
environmental sustainability in the semi-arid Sudano-Sahelian belt of Katsina
State, Northern Nigeria, where climate variability, rapid population growth,
land degradation, and weak cross-sectoral coordination intensify pressure on
water, energy, and food systems. Adopting a mixed-methods, cross-sectional
design, the study combines a structured household questionnaire administered to
384 respondents, determined using Cochran’s sample size formula, with key
informant interviews (KIIs) involving officials of relevant Ministries,
Departments and Agencies (MDAs), local government functionaries, and
community/traditional leaders across six purposively selected Local Government
Areas (LGAs). A four-layer conceptual framework integrating Hoff’s WEF Nexus
model, Ostrom’s Institutional Analysis and Development (IAD) framework, and
polycentric governance theory guides the analysis of contextual drivers, nexus
interactions, institutional arrangements, and optimization strategies.
Quantitative data are analysed descriptively and inferentially using SPSS
(including correlation and regression), while qualitative data undergo thematic
analysis in NVivo, with findings triangulated across both strands. The study is
expected to reveal significant trade-offs and synergies among the three
sectors, fragmented institutional coordination among MDAs, low uptake of
integrated resource-efficient technologies, and a strong association between
polycentric governance capacity and nexus optimization outcomes. The paper
concludes with a set of governance-oriented recommendations and contributes a
replicable, context-specific analytical framework applicable to other semi-arid
regions of the Sudano-Sahelian zone and comparable dryland settings in
sub-Saharan Africa.
